Yancheng 1 Day Itinerary

Embark on a delightful one-day journey in Yancheng, where nature's beauty unfolds in a vibrant display. Begin your adventure at the Dutch Flower Sea, a characteristic neighborhood known for its sprawling fields of flowers that create a kaleidoscopic tapestry. Spend two hours wandering through the fragrant blooms, capturing the perfect photo, and enjoying the tranquil atmosphere. After immersing yourself in the floral paradise, continue to the Huanghai Forest Park. This natural haven offers a museum experience amidst the lush greenery. Allocate another two hours to explore the forest trails, learn about the local ecosystem, and find peace under the canopy of ancient trees. This itinerary promises a day filled with the simple joys of nature's artistry and the serene embrace of Yancheng's unique landscapes.

1 Day in Yancheng Itinerary: Day 1

1

Dutch Flower Sea

arrow-image

Kickstart your Yancheng journey amidst a kaleidoscope of colors at the Dutch Flower Sea, the first stop in today's itinerary. Nestled in the heart of Chengbei New District, this characteristic neighborhood offers a floral feast for the senses. Spend a couple of hours wandering through vibrant rows of blossoms, which provide a picturesque backdrop for both leisurely strolls and photo enthusiasts alike. The Dutch Flower Sea is not just a visual delight; it's a place where the beauty of nature and the charm of Dutch-inspired landscapes merge to create an unforgettable experience.

Attraction Info

  • No.1, Chengbei New District, Xinfeng Town, Dafeng City, Yancheng City
  • Suggested tour duration: 2-4 hour
  • Open from 8:30am-5:00pm

Huanghai Forest Park

arrow-image

Continue your day's exploration with a visit to the Huanghai Forest Park, a sanctuary of natural beauty and cultural treasures. Located on Hualin Road within the Coastal Economic Zone, this park is a seamless blend of lush forestry and engaging museum exhibits. Allocate another two hours to immerse yourself in the serene ambiance of the woods and enrich your knowledge of the region's ecological diversity. The Huanghai Forest Park is an ideal spot for both relaxation and education, making it a perfect second destination on your Yancheng adventure.

Attraction Info

  • No. 8, Hualin Road, Coastal Economic Zone, Dongtai City, Yancheng City
  • Suggested tour duration: 2-3 hour
  • Open from 8:30am-5:00pm

Dafeng Elk National Nature Reserve
Dafeng Elk National Nature Reserve
4.5/5 · 1,946 review
Highlights:
The Dafeng Milu National Nature Reserve is located in the Dafeng Forest on the coast of the Yellow Sea. The terrain is a mix of woodlands, grasslands, marshlands and bare salt planes. It is a typical tidal flat wetland. In addition to elk, there are many rare and protected animals, such as red-crowned cranes, oriental white storks and white-tailed sea eagles. This is a great place to get closer to these precious animals.

Dutch Flower Sea
Dutch Flower Sea
4.6/5 · 2,355 review
Highlights:
The Holland Flower Park is located in Yancheng City, Jiangsu Province. It features famous Dutch tulips and was designed with elements of the countryside, a river network, wooden buildings, windmills, and a sea of flowers. When the tulips are in full bloom during spring, tourists will stroll around in this ocean of flowers, and children will chase each other in jubilee. This creates a tableau with a strong stereographic effect.

Huanghai Forest Park
Huanghai Forest Park
4.6/5 · 1,100 review
Highlights:
Huanghai Forest Park is a large-scale man-made ecological forest park. The park was formerly a forest farm. There are electric power tour carts available, but it is also very convenient for walking. The park has attractions such as wetland promenade, bamboo island, bird garden, and OCBC skyway. The wetland promenade is dominated by cedar trees, and there are a large variety of birds in the bird garden. It is a nice place for a picnic with family and friends.

Yancheng Wetland National Nature Reserve Rare Birds
Yancheng Wetland National Nature Reserve Rare Birds
4.5/5 · 993 review
taCommentInfo-imageBased on 8 review
Highlights:

Yancheng Red-crowned Crane Wetland Ecological Tourism Area is located in Tinghu District, Yancheng City, covering an area of ​​16,000 acres and belongs to the Yancheng National Rare Bird Nature Reserve in Jiangsu Province. The tourist area has beautiful natural scenery and is known as the "Pearl of the Yellow Sea and Ecological Corridor". The tourist area has been successively established as a science popularization education base in Jiangsu Province, an ecological tourism demonstration zone in Jiangsu Province, a national environmental protection science popularization base, a national ecological environment science popularization base, a national forestry and grass science popularization base, a national youth nature education green camp, and a national AAAA-level tourist attraction. In 2019 Included in the World Natural Heritage Site.


Since its establishment, the tourist area has been based on the two major advantages of Yancheng's tidal wetland natural landscape and rich crane cultural resources. Taking the auspiciousness, love and longevity in the red-crowned crane culture as the main thread, it has focused on creating wetland sightseeing tours, ecological bird watching tours, and research and popular science tours. and other themed tourism to fully demonstrate the harmony and beauty between man and nature. Entering the tourist area, the artemisia is as red as blood and the reeds are as green as jade; here are small bridges and flowing water, where fish and shrimps play; here mandarin ducks dance and swans sing; here cranes fly and thousands of birds gather; being in it is like a fairyland. There is a song "A True Story" in the tourist area that is sung all over the country. It tells the touching story of martyr Xu Xiujuan. She unfortunately drowned and died in order to save two missing swans. At the age of only 23, she transformed into the "Crane Fairy" "Always protecting this pure land and birds, she played the strongest voice of ecological civilization with her life, and will be forever remembered by the times.


There are attractions in the park: Red-crowned Crane Museum, Waterfowl Lake, Red-crowned Crane Rescue and Breeding Center, Rare Bird Garden, Ecological Eye, Heron Tracks in the Willow Forest, etc.
